Transaction 50c906cc20151806ccef794ff7318700310c59dfb54f4f049ad3cb5da266089a

2 Input
2 Outputs
  • 50c906cc20151806ccef794ff7318700310c59dfb54f4f049ad3cb5da266089a:0
  • value  9979532
    address  32fQFJmvqwMDWPvCk81bE8dyGS1aggZ2w6
  • 50c906cc20151806ccef794ff7318700310c59dfb54f4f049ad3cb5da266089a:1
  • value  84740751
    address  3G4SikBU8K3DhF2xsL2EUXSGqprTffXBQH